Output 759695622919bf24218cf51b65ad9f2a49f61b8d38ba3052bec43994d366722e:0

value
516949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61664ef72d158aa58a14ad3dd1914768736195da OP_EQUAL
address
3Aa22fgGvBmMZ5mE8LGykqcgjbjfkmSVJh
transaction
759695622919bf24218cf51b65ad9f2a49f61b8d38ba3052bec43994d366722e